Visa unveils Intelligent Commerce Connect, a platform that facilitates payments for AI agents across multiple card networks, including those of Visa competitors

Context & Ripple Effects

Visa is extending a long-running effort to make its network infrastructure useful beyond conventional card checkout: it previously developed AI-based transaction decisioning for bank outages and tested a separate B2B payment rail through its blockchain-based B2B Connect pilot. Intelligent Commerce Connect applies that platform role to agent-initiated purchases.

The cross-network design matters because it positions Visa as an orchestration layer rather than solely the operator of its own card rails. Subsequent coverage of Visa's partnership with OpenAI on permissioned agent purchases suggests that agentic checkout is moving from a payments-network capability toward integrations with the AI interfaces consumers and businesses may use.

First-order effects

  • Visa can offer merchants, issuers and agent builders a single integration path for AI-agent payments spanning Visa and competing card networks.
  • AI agents gain a payments route that can operate across networks, while Visa gains a role in transaction flows that would otherwise be tied to individual card-network integrations.

Second-order effects

  • Competing networks and payment providers face greater pressure to expose interoperable agent-payment capabilities or risk being abstracted behind Visa's platform layer.
  • Merchant and AI-platform integrations may shift attention from accepting a particular network to managing permissions, payment credentials and controls for agent-led transactions.

Third-order effects

  • If cross-network platforms become the standard access point, value in card payments could increasingly accrue to the party that governs agent authorization and orchestration, not just the underlying payment rail.
  • This points to a more permissioned form of agentic commerce, where scalable adoption will depend on interoperable controls that users, merchants and financial institutions accept.

The trend: Payment networks are repositioning themselves as trusted orchestration infrastructure for permissioned AI agents, seeking to retain relevance as checkout moves into AI-driven interfaces.
